Ticket: PIXWIPE-872. Heads up — the EXIF scrubber release 4.2 is bouncing off the verifier again. Looks like the build box re-zipped the artifact after signing (timestamps differ by two minutes), so the hash no longer matches the detached signature. Quick fix: sign as the final step in the pipeline, not before the compression pass. I've patched the Makefile accordingly and re-cut the release. Future maintainers, don't reorder those steps. For verification, the team's current release signing key is the following.

rollout seal: bky4_x7Gc

Action item (PM-412, Larkspur outage): we burned 40 minutes because the schema migration locked the orders table. Going forward, all migrations on Quillback services must follow the zero-downtime pattern — expand, backfill, contract — no exceptions, even for "tiny" column adds. If you're on call and a deploy includes a migration, check it was run through the migration linter first. The step-by-step guide, including rollback tips, lives on the wiki page here.

wiki page, bagaf-fawip: https://harbor.tolvaqsys.local/pages/repo/pages/secrets/eac969ffc71f356b

## Bramblewick environments: request tracing

Welcome aboard. Bramblewick runs three environments — dev, staging, prod — and traces propagate across all internal microservices via a shared header set injected at the edge. If spans look orphaned, it's almost always a service stripping headers; check the gateway first. Sampling rates differ per environment, so don't compare trace volume across them directly. Each environment's tracing agent is configured with the values shown here.

config for bagag-hahag:
DRUION_PIN=7963
DRUION_TENANT=quenax
DRUION_METRICS_HOST=metrics.druion.lumicnet.internal
DRUION_SEAL=seal_567a1f37
DRUION_STANDBY_TEAM=sorael

### Telemetry Compression

Heads up: the Pinwheel ingest endpoint expects telemetry payloads compressed with zstd, level 3. Gzip still works but gets you throttled, so don't bother. Batches over 2 MB (post-compression) are rejected outright — split them. Set the Content-Encoding header or the collector will treat bytes as plaintext and choke. Requests authenticate against the internal Mastic gateway, and you'll want the key below for that.

gateway credential: kto7_GoY89Me